The release of Monster Hunter Wilds is gradually approaching, and the first monsters have already been introduced. The community has its own wishes about which of the already known monsters they want to see again in the new title. However, for some of them, a return is very unlikely.
Which monsters does the community wish for? More and more players are discussing on social media about which of their favorite monsters they want to fight again in Monster Hunter Wilds. Especially on reddit.com, threads are increasingly appearing where this topic is being hotly debated.
Names like Diablos, Jyuratodus, Kushala Daora, or Teostra and Bazelgeuse are mentioned frequently. However, it is noticeable that especially amphibious and swimming monsters like Lagiacrus, Plesioth, or Royal Ludroth are also frequently named. But especially for this type of monster, a spot in Monster Hunter Wilds is unfortunately quite unlikely, as they have one thing in common: they were primarily found in water before.
No comeback despite exploration underwater?
Why is a return unlikely? Monsters like Lagiacrus or Plesioth are known for their insane underwater battles. However, these have not existed in this form since Monster Hunter 3 Ultimate, and the developers have increasingly focused on other game elements.
In a dev stream, it was confirmed for Monster Hunter Wilds that there will be underwater areas, but for now, there will be no underwater battles. The reason for this is that it would be like developing a separate game and would therefore cost too many resources. This unfortunately makes a return of the typical water monsters less likely.
In principle, it is possible to incorporate amphibious monsters, such as Royal Ludroth, at least in fights on land. This was also the case in Monster Hunter World, for example. However, it was the underwater battles that made the appeal with monsters like Lagiacrus and Plesioth.
The fact that these two monsters have hardly had any real appearances since the disappearance of underwater battles also argues against a reappearance and for the inseparability of the game element and the water monsters.
Are there counter theories? However, it is still not completely ruled out that these beasts might make a comeback. Particularly for Lagiacrus, some fan theories seem to be gaining traction, suggesting that a return is even likely.

Lagiacrus is also one of the Leviathans and could thus receive another chance to prove itself, perhaps even without epic battles underwater. Other water monsters could also receive an amphibious upgrade or be incorporated in some other way, so a reunion is not entirely off the table.
